CHAPTER 1: INTRODUCTION SPECIFICATIONS
869 MOTOR PROTECTION SYSTEM – INSTRUCTION MANUAL 1–19
UNDERFREQUENCY (81U)
Pickup Level:..........................................................20.00 to 65.00 Hz in steps of 0.01
Dropout Level: ......................................................Pickup + 0.03 Hz
Pickup Time Delay:.............................................0.000 to 6000.000 s in steps of 0.001s
Dropout Time Delay: .........................................0.000 to 6000.000 s in steps of 0.001s
Minimum Operating Voltage: ........................0.000 to 1.250 x VT in steps of 0.001 x VT
Minimum Operating Current: ........................0.000 to 30.000 x CT in steps of 0.001 x CT
Level Accuracy:....................................................± 0.001 Hz
Timer Accuracy: ..................................................± 3% of delay setting or ± ¼ cycle (whichever is greater)
from pickup to operate
Operate Time:.......................................................typically 7.5 cycles at 0.1 Hz/s change
typically 7 cycles at 0.3 Hz/s change
typically 6.5 cycles at 0.5 Hz/s change
FAST PATH:
Typical times are average Operate Times including variables such as frequency change
instance, test method, etc., and may vary by ± 0.5 cycles.
UNDERPOWER
Operating Condition:.........................................Three-phase real power
Number of Elements: ........................................1, alarm and trip stages
Trip/Alarm Pickup Level: ..................................1 to 25000 kW in steps of 1
Pickup Level Accuracy: ....................................±1.0% of reading
Hysteresis:..............................................................3%
Trip/Alarm Pickup Delay:.................................0 to 180.00 s in steps of 0.01
Timer Accuracy: ..................................................±3% of delay time or ±10 ms, whichever is greater, pick up to
operate
Operate Time:.......................................................<45 ms at 60 Hz; <50 ms at 50 Hz (NOTE 1)
VOLTS PER HERTZ (24)
Voltages:..................................................................Phasor only
Pickup Level:..........................................................0.80 to 4.00 in steps of 0.01 pu
Dropout Level: ......................................................97 to 98% of pickup
Level Accuracy:....................................................±0.02 pu
Timing Curves: .....................................................Definite Time; IEC Inverse A/B/C; FlexCurves A, B, C, and D
TD Multiplier: .........................................................0.05 to 600.00 s in steps of 0.01
Reset Delay:...........................................................0.00 to 6000.000 s in steps of 0.01
Timer Accuracy: ..................................................±3% of operate time or ±15 cycles (whichever is greater) for
values greater than 1.1 x pickup
Number of Elements: ........................................2
Number of Elements: ........................................1
(NOTE 1) When the setpoint “Motor Load Filter Interval” is programmed as non-zero, it
might increase the trip/alarm times by 16.7 ms (or 20 ms at 50 Hz) for each additional
cycle in the filter interval for the following protection elements: Acceleration Time, Current
Unbalance, Mechanical Jam, Overload Alarm, Thermal Model, Undercurent, Power Factor,
and Underpower.
